About 6 weeks ago, I was on a road trip down to Southern California, and spent a good deal of time in the Los Angeles area. Since it was the middle of the division races, I made a mental note to compare the level of support for the Angels and the Dodgers. What I found shouldn't have been surprising, but it was.
I spent several days in Los Angeles County and a few days in the OC. How many people wearing Dodgers gear did I see in LA County? Too many to count. How many people did I see wearing Angels gear in LA County? Zero. None. Nada. I saw plenty of people decked out in Angels gear down in Orange County (including one who looked suspiciously like Bill Bavasi), but none in LA county.
There are two possible explanations for this:
- There are hardly any Angels fans in the actual city of Los Angeles.
- The Angels fans in LA proper are a bunch of posers and pretenders who don't wear their colors outside of the ballpark.
